United Kingdom, Aug. 6 -- Prince Harry was "unsurprised" that an investigation into the charity he co-founded has ruled he had done nothing wrong.

The 40-year-old royal - who founded Sentebale almost 20 years ago with Prince Seeiso of Lesotho to offer support for people in southern African battling HIV and Aids - stepped down from the charity in March after a row between the trustees and chair Dr. Sophie Chandauka, and a subsequent investigation launched by the Charity Commission for England and Wales released its findings on Tuesday (05.08.25).

The probe found no evidence of the chair's allegations of "widespread or systemic bullying, harassment, misogyny or misogynoir" at Sentebale, nor any "overreach" by either Harry or Sophie.
